Transaction 70d72a3e43147643bb5931b63a515e12a773d781b3723f781f39cc5b39805427
3 Input
1 Outputs
- 70d72a3e43147643bb5931b63a515e12a773d781b3723f781f39cc5b39805427:0
value 113007925
address 3AsgoSAskcrGfudR9rYjTKn3PxWtZTqqJe